Proposal
T023 Pedunculate Oak - Reduce canopy to give a clearance of 2m from the lamp column. Remove deadwood larger than 10mm in diameter. T024 Oak - Prune clear of bus shelter and remove major dead wood.T025 Ash - Remove broken branch, reduce remainder of canopy by maximum of 2m.T027 Ash - Reduce stem with failure wound by 4m (this appears to have been undertaken by an MOD appointed contractor). Reduce remainder of crown by 2m. (After the shortening of the faulted stem, the remainder of the crown requires balancing).

About tree works applications
Applications for works to trees cover protected trees: consent under a tree preservation order, or six weeks notice for trees in a conservation area. More in our guide to planning application types.
